For many of us, the way we define contentment is the very thing that makes us discontent. As long as we believe contentment is self-sufficiency based on having all the provision and protection we need – we will never be content. The enemy of our soul subtly deceives us into defining contentment in a way that makes us independent of our abiding need for Christ. The moment we learn our sufficiency and true contentment is in Christ and always will be -- we begin to grasp the secret of contentment.
